策略概述,闡述了在惡劣環境下採用兆赫成像測試的科學基礎、實際能力和工業合理性。

兆赫成像檢測已成為一種獨特的檢測方式,它將電磁感測與實用無損檢測相結合,並應用於多個工業領域。基於亞毫米波物理學原理,兆赫系統無需使用電離輻射即可探測材料成分、層級構造和隱藏特徵,從而為敏感物品、法規環境和複雜組件的檢測流程開闢了新的途徑。隨著硬體和訊號處理技術的日益成熟,兆赫成像已從實驗室驗證發展成為整合了檢測器、光源、光學元件和軟體的工程儀器,從而能夠在現場和工廠中實現可重複應用。

透過綜合分析,將特定應用需求、最終使用者工作流程、架構選擇和組件級約束連結起來,以確定兆赫系統的適用性。

以細分市場為中心的觀點揭示了特定應用、最終用戶、系統類型、分銷管道、組件和頻率範圍如何塑造兆赫成像檢測解決方案的獨特價值提案和商業化路徑。在醫學影像領域,人們正在探索將兆赫技術應用於組織表徵和皮膚診斷。同時,在無損檢測領域,太赫茲技術的應用範圍十分廣泛,從工業零件檢測到私人資產的基礎設施檢測,其中亞表面分析和分層檢測是優先考慮的問題。在製藥檢測領域,應用案例包括包衣檢測(用於檢驗均勻性)和片劑檢測(用於確認內部完整性),這些都需要高度的可重複性和法規可追溯性。在安檢領域,太赫茲技術的應用範圍涵蓋機場安檢、海關和邊境管制以及小包裹檢查,其中非電離檢測技術可以有效補充現有方法,用於檢測隱藏的威脅和走私貨。

The Terahertz Imaging Inspection System Market was valued at USD 75.44 million in 2025 and is projected to grow to USD 84.38 million in 2026, with a CAGR of 6.33%, reaching USD 115.93 million by 2032.

KEY MARKET STATISTICS
Base Year [2025] USD 75.44 million
Estimated Year [2026] USD 84.38 million
Forecast Year [2032] USD 115.93 million
CAGR (%) 6.33%

A strategic overview explaining the scientific basis, practical capabilities, and industrial rationale that underpin terahertz imaging inspection adoption across demanding environments

Terahertz imaging inspection has emerged as a distinct modality that bridges electromagnetic sensing and practical nondestructive assessment across multiple industry contexts. Grounded in sub-millimeter wave physics, terahertz systems probe material composition, layer structure, and concealed features without ionizing radiation, enabling new inspection workflows for sensitive items, regulated environments, and complex assemblies. As hardware and signal processing techniques have matured, terahertz imaging has moved from laboratory demonstrations into engineered instruments that integrate detectors, sources, optics, and software for repeatable field and factory use.

In parallel, advances in detector sensitivity, source power, and computational imaging have improved throughput and reliability, allowing terahertz systems to address previously intractable inspection questions. Transitioning from proof-of-concept to operational use requires careful alignment of system capabilities with application requirements, regulatory constraints, and end-user processes. Therefore, stakeholders must evaluate not only raw performance metrics but also integration aspects such as form factor, ease of use, data interpretation workflows, and maintainability. Ultimately, a pragmatic understanding of capabilities and limits fosters realistic deployment pathways and unlocks value across medical, industrial, pharmaceutical, quality assurance, and security domains.

Comprehensive segmentation analysis connecting application-specific requirements, end-user workflows, architectural choices, and component-level constraints that determine terahertz system suitability

A segmentation-centered view reveals how specific applications, end users, system types, distribution channels, components, and frequency ranges inform distinct value propositions and commercialization pathways for terahertz imaging inspection solutions. In medical imaging, terahertz modalities are being explored for tissue characterization and dermatological assessment, while in nondestructive testing the focus spans both industrial inspection of components and infrastructure inspection of civil assets where subsurface layer analysis and delamination detection are priorities. Pharmaceutical inspection use cases include coating inspection to verify uniformity and tablet inspection to confirm internal integrity, which demand high repeatability and regulatory traceability. Security inspection applications range from airport security screening to customs and border control and parcel inspection, where non-ionizing detection of concealed threats and contraband can complement existing modalities.

End-user segmentation underscores that automotive deployment often centers on manufacturing inspection and safety testing to detect defects in composites and bonded assemblies, whereas electronics customers prioritize printed circuit board inspection and semiconductor inspection for process control and yield improvement. System-type differentiation between continuous wave and pulsed architectures affects tradeoffs in penetration depth, resolution, and acquisition speed, influencing suitability for specific tasks. Distribution choices-direct sales, distributors, and online stores-shape buyer experience, service models, and aftermarket support obligations. Component-level segmentation highlights detector, optics, software and other ancillary systems, and source as critical nodes where performance, cost, and supply continuity converge. Finally, frequency range considerations, from sub-THz bands through 3 THz-10 THz and beyond 10 THz, dictate material contrast, spatial resolution, and atmospheric susceptibility, thereby guiding both laboratory validation and field deployment decisions.

Regional market dynamics and infrastructure influences across the Americas, Europe, Middle East & Africa, and Asia-Pacific that shape adoption, supply chains, and commercialization pathways

Regional dynamics play a pivotal role in the maturation and adoption of terahertz imaging inspection systems. The Americas show a strong emphasis on industrial applications and security screening, driven by advanced manufacturing clusters and regulatory interest in non-ionizing inspection alternatives. Investment in domestic supply chains and research institutions in the region supports prototype-to-production pathways and encourages collaboration between OEMs and end users.

In Europe, Middle East & Africa, regulatory harmonization and standards development are shaping procurement preferences, while infrastructure inspection and pharmaceutical quality assurance are salient drivers for system deployment. Cross-border research collaboration and a dense ecosystem of specialized integrators enable applied validation programs that accelerate adoption in regulated sectors. Meanwhile, Asia-Pacific exhibits fast-growing demand across electronics and automotive sectors, where high-volume manufacturing and strong semiconductor ecosystems foster intense interest in inline inspection and process control. The region's manufacturing scale also creates a dynamic market for component suppliers, enabling cost-competitive sourcing but also intensifying competition among system vendors. Across these regions, varying regulatory regimes, infrastructure maturity, and procurement processes create distinct commercialization trajectories and emphasize the importance of regionally tailored strategies.
